To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Singapore to Belgium,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Singapore to Belgium is March, when tickets cost S$ 890 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and August, when the average cost of return tickets is S$ 1,380 and S$ 1,363 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Singapore to Belgium?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Singapore to Belgium,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below-average price on the flight from Singapore to Belgium,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 26 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Singapore to Belgium?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ly from Singapore to Belgium with an airline and back with another airline.
